TIGR02070 mono_pep_trsgly 1.74e-83 2 212 11 221
monofunctional biosynthetic peptidoglycan transglycosylase. This family is one of the transglycosylases involved in the late stages of peptidoglycan biosynthesis. Members tend to be small, about 240 amino acids in length, and consist almost entirely of a domain described by pfam00912 for transglycosylases. Species with this protein will have several other transglycosylases as well. All species with this protein are Proteobacteria that produce murein (peptidoglycan). [Cell envelope, Biosynthesis and degradation of murein sacculus and peptidoglycan]
pfam00912 Transgly 5.75e-68 37 210 1 177
Transglycosylase. The penicillin-binding proteins are bifunctional proteins consisting of transglycosylase and transpeptidase in the N- and C-terminus respectively. The transglycosylase domain catalyzes the polymerization of murein glycan chains.

TIGR02074 PBP_1a_fam 4.08e-43 47 214 4 173
penicillin-binding protein, 1A family. Bacterial that synthesize a cell wall of peptidoglycan (murein) generally have several transglycosylases and transpeptidases for the task. This family consists of bifunctional transglycosylase/transpeptidase penicillin-binding proteins (PBP). In the Proteobacteria, this family includes PBP 1A but not the paralogous PBP 1B (TIGR02071). This family also includes related proteins, often designated PBP 1A, from other bacterial lineages. [Cell envelope, Biosynthesis and degradation of murein sacculus and peptidoglycan]
